Real estate teams need fast lead response, clean showing coordination, listing prep, transaction checklists, and follow-up that continues after closing. AutoSolve Labs helps automate coordination while agents keep relationship and negotiation ownership.
This is you if...
Inbound buyer and seller leads require fast follow-up. Showing coordination creates repeated back-and-forth. Listing prep tasks are easy to miss before launch. Transaction milestones depend on manual reminders. Post-close review and referral follow-up is inconsistent.
First workflow to catch
Lead response + showing coordination
First automations worth testing
Lead response and qualification workflow with appointment handoff. Showing coordination reminders and availability collection. Listing prep checklist for photos, staging, disclosures, and launch tasks. Transaction milestone reminder workflow. Post-close review/referral and nurture sequence.
What to measure
Lead response time, Appointment booked rate, Showing coordination touches, Listing prep completion, Referral/review follow-up completion

Frequently asked questions
Can AI negotiate or advise clients?
No. It should handle coordination, reminders, and structured intake while agents own advice, negotiation, and relationships.
What is the fastest first workflow?
Lead response and showing coordination are usually high-leverage and measurable.
Can this work with a CRM?
Yes, but the first version can also route summaries and tasks into existing team workflows.
